How Addiction Affects the Brain: The Neuroscience of Dependency

Addiction is more than a behavioral issue—it is a chronic brain disease that fundamentally alters how the brain functions. The neuroscience of addiction reveals how substances hijack the brain’s reward systems, leading to compulsive use and dependency. Understanding these changes can help demystify addiction and support better treatment strategies.
